Complex design from start to finish - 3D design for 3D printing pt11
To get the best out of 3D printing, it helps if you can design your own parts. In this tutorial series, we will learn to use a free 3D CAD program to do just that.
In this episode, I design a more complex part from start to finish to show the complete step by step process. This part is formed by using extrudes, revolves, sweeps and lofts. It is an excellent showcase of the workflow of parametric 3D modelling.
